Wow. That is an absolutely vile and disgusting comment. I hope it is due to ignorance on your part and upon reflection you’ll realise how appalling it is.

Or do you think anything to that happens to her from this point on at his hands is her fault?

You do understand there are over 1.5m domestic violence related incidents recorded by police forces in the UK each year. If it was so simple for abuse victims to escape from abusive partners that wouldn’t be the case would it?

The toll on the mental health of the victims must be indescribable. Abusers isolate their victims. Stop them seeing their friends and family. Make them totally dependent on them for everything. They control their finances. They control where the victim can and can’t go. What they can and can’t wear. And the victim has no say in all the things that in a normal healthy relationship are agreed between 2 equal people (like when they have sex).

For you to throw some blame on to a victim who, unsurprisingly given what appears to have happened to her and how it has been played out in public, isn’t strong enough to break the cycle of abuse is quite frankly despicable.

Domestic abuse victims aren’t fixed when the cuts and bruises are all healed.

1 in 4 women in the UK have been the victims of domestic abuse.

Easy to say this sat at home and not being the victim of domestic abuse. The hold that the abuser has over them lasts for years and they feel unable to live without them because they've been told that they can't and had their life controlled by them. She spoke out which takes bravery. It would be great if all of these events ended in prosecution, but a lot of people that speak out later withdraw their statements out of fear. It is incredibly difficult to escape that kind of situation.

She may have done it for money, I'm sure deep down she loves him. Whatever has happened, it isn't her fault.
